数据库字段的码值是什么
-
数据库字段的码值是指数据库中每个字段的具体取值范围和含义。它用于表示字段的状态、类型、长度、约束等信息。数据库字段的码值通常由数据库管理系统(DBMS)定义和维护,不同的DBMS可能会有不同的码值。
以下是数据库字段的码值的一些常见含义和分类:
-
数据类型:数据库字段的码值可以表示字段的数据类型,例如整数、浮点数、字符串、日期等。不同的数据类型对应不同的码值,用于告诉DBMS如何存储和处理字段的数据。
-
约束条件:数据库字段的码值可以表示字段的约束条件,例如主键、外键、唯一约束、非空约束等。这些码值用于告诉DBMS如何验证和限制字段的取值范围。
-
字段长度:数据库字段的码值可以表示字段的长度限制,例如字符串字段的最大长度、数字字段的精度等。这些码值用于告诉DBMS如何分配存储空间和验证字段的长度。
-
编码方式:数据库字段的码值可以表示字段的编码方式,例如UTF-8、GBK、ISO-8859-1等。这些码值用于告诉DBMS如何解析和处理字段的字符集。
-
状态信息:数据库字段的码值可以表示字段的状态信息,例如是否可为空、是否自增、是否索引等。这些码值用于告诉DBMS如何处理字段的特殊属性和行为。
需要注意的是,不同的DBMS可能会有不同的码值定义和命名规范,所以在使用数据库字段的码值时需要查阅相关的文档和参考资料。此外,数据库字段的码值通常是只读的,用户无法直接修改或定义字段的码值。
1年前 -
-
数据库字段的码值是指数据库中存储的数据所对应的编码值。在数据库中,每个字段都有相应的数据类型,不同的数据类型对应着不同的编码方式。
常见的数据库字段数据类型包括整数型、浮点型、字符型、日期型等。每个数据类型都有固定的编码规则,用来表示不同的数据值。
例如,整数型的编码规则是使用二进制表示数字,浮点型的编码规则是使用二进制表示小数,字符型的编码规则是使用ASCII码或Unicode码表示字符,日期型的编码规则是使用特定的日期格式表示日期。
对于整数型字段,码值是一个整数;对于浮点型字段,码值是一个浮点数;对于字符型字段,码值是一个字符串;对于日期型字段,码值是一个日期。
数据库字段的码值在数据库中起到了关键的作用,它们用来存储和表示数据,并且在数据库的操作中起到了重要的作用,如排序、比较和计算等。在进行数据库设计和数据操作时,了解和理解字段的码值是非常重要的。
1年前 -
数据库字段的码值是指将字段的实际值通过某种方法转换成一个唯一的标识符,用于在数据库中进行存储和索引的值。码值通常是一个整数,用来代表字段值的含义。
在数据库中,为了提高查询效率和节省存储空间,常常使用码值来代替实际值进行存储和索引。通过使用码值,可以将字段的实际值转换成一个较小的整数,在数据库中进行存储和索引,从而减少存储空间和提高查询效率。
下面是一个常见的数据库字段码值的实现方法和操作流程:
-
码值表的创建:首先,需要创建一个码值表,用于存储字段的实际值和对应的码值。码值表通常包含两个字段,一个是实际值字段,用于存储字段的实际值;另一个是码值字段,用于存储字段的码值。
-
码值表的填充:将字段的实际值和对应的码值插入到码值表中。可以使用INSERT语句将数据插入到码值表中。
-
码值字段的添加:在需要使用码值的字段上,添加一个新的字段,用于存储字段的码值。可以使用ALTER TABLE语句添加字段。
-
码值字段的更新:使用UPDATE语句将字段的实际值转换成码值,并将码值存储到码值字段中。可以使用JOIN语句将字段的实际值和码值表进行关联,根据实际值查找对应的码值,并将码值更新到码值字段。
-
码值字段的查询:使用SELECT语句查询码值字段。在查询结果中,可以通过JOIN语句将码值字段和码值表进行关联,根据码值查找对应的实际值,并将实际值返回。
-
码值字段的索引:为了提高查询效率,可以对码值字段创建索引。通过创建索引,可以加速码值字段的查询和排序操作。
总结:数据库字段的码值是将字段的实际值转换成一个唯一的标识符,用于在数据库中进行存储和索引的值。通过使用码值,可以减少存储空间和提高查询效率。实现方法包括创建码值表、填充码值表、添加码值字段、更新码值字段、查询码值字段和索引码值字段。
1年前 -